Keep your eyes on Jesus not the storm!
In Matthew 14 it talks about Jesus sending his disciples away in a boat, while he stayed behind to pray. At evening, vs. 24 "but the boat was now in the middle of the sea, tossed by the waves, for the wind was contrary." vs. 25 "Now in the fourth watch of the night Jesus went to them, walking on the sea." The disciples were afraid. vs. 27 "But immediately Jesus spoke to them, saying "Be of good cheer! It is I; do not be afraid." Vs. 28 "And Peter answered Him and said, "Lord, if it is you, command me to come to you on the water." vs. 29, "So He said " come". And when Peter had come down out of the boat, he walked on the water to go to Jesus." Vs. 30 " But when he saw that the wind was boisterous, he was afraid; and beginning to sink he cried out, saying, "Lord save me!" Vs. 31 "and immediately Jesus stretched out His hand and caught him, and said to him, "O you of little faith, why did you doubt?" vs. 32 "And when they got into the boat the wind ceased."
Too many times people want to give Peter a hard time because they say he doubted and did not have enough faith to walk on the water, but he did "walk on the water". How many of us, have walked on water? It took faith just to get out of the boat. How many of us, has even got out of the boat? The thing I learned from Peter is this: when Peter kept his eyes on Jesus, as he got out of the boat, he could walk on water. When Peter put his eyes on the storm around him, he began to sink. This applys to us also. Storms of life will come and try to knock us down. That is life, we will have storms. It is how we deal with the storms of life, that makes a difference. If we keep our eyes on Jesus during the storm, then we won't be knocked down (we won't sink!). But if we keep our eyes on the storm (our problems) then we will be brought down with them (we will sink). A cool thing also is, if we do sink, Jesus will outstretch His hand and pick us up (vs. 31)
Bottom line: keep your eyes on Jesus (stay focused on Him), not the circumstances and problems around you.

March 31-Proverbs 31:10-31
We all know about the Proverbs 31 wife, but ladies be honest, have you ever wondered, how can I ever do all that she does or be like that? Men, you are probably saying,"yeah, that is some kind of wife." The most important attribute of this wife is in verse 30 "But a woman who fears the Lord, she shall be praised". Men, when you find a woman who fears the Lord and loves the Lord with all her heart, you have found a "Good" woman! A woman who loves the Lord will do all that she can to take care of her family and bless them. "Strength and honor are her clothing" vs. 25 and "she will open her mouth with wisdom and on her tongue is the law of kindness" vs. 26. A woman of the Lord will be a blessing to people all around her. Ladies, don't beat yourself up and say I can't compare with this Proverbs 31 wife, don't say to yourself I don't do all the things that she does because you do more than you realize. We may not get up in the middle of the night to cook, or sew all our family's clothes, but look at what you do! Whether you are a working mom/wife or a stay at home mom/wife, you are of much value and the things you do for your family there is no price value. Truly," her children shall rise up and call her blessed;her husband also, and he praises her."vs. 28
Bottom line: men, if you have found a woman who fears and loves the Lord, you are blessed! Honor your wife!
Ladies, if you fear the Lord and love the Lord with all your heart and do everything you can to bless your family, then you truly are a Proverbs 31 wife!

March 29-Proverbs 29:5-6
Proverbs 29:5-6 says, "Every word of God is pure; He is a shield to those who put their trust in Him. Do not add to His words, Lest He rebuke you, and you be found a liar."
The Word of God is pure. We need not dilute it or take away from it. It stands on its own and is powerful. In Deutronomy4:2 Moses gives a warning to the people not to add or take away from the Word. In Revelation 22:18, John warns that if anyone adds to these things (the words of the prophecy), God will add to him the plagues that are written in the book of Revelation. These are pretty stern warnings about taking or adding to the Word of God, whether it is the written Word or the spoken Word, we need to be careful not to do this. Again, the Word of God is pure, we don't need to add to it or take away from it to satisfy ourselves with what we want to hear.

March 28-Proverbs 28:13
Proverbs 28:13 says, "He who covers his sin will not prosper, But whoever confesses and forsakes them will have mercy."
If we try to cover up a sin and pretend they don't exist, it won't work. You may be able to fool people for awhile but it will be found out. If we cover up a sin we will not be able to prosper. The longer we hold on to sin,the worst things will get in our lives. We won't be able to prosper in any area of our life. Sometimes the Lord will allow us to prosper for awhile but if we continue to cover up our sins, no area of our lives will prosper. However, if we "confess and forsake them (sin) then we will have mercy." The mercy of the Lord is so wonderful, none of us deserve it but because of the Lord's lovingkindness and longsuffering with us, He gives it to us. Isn't it so wonderful that when we turn from our sins, that He will have mercy on us and change us!
